深度学习的特点有哪些?

深度学习的特点

深度学习作为人工智能的核心技术之一,以其强大的数据处理能力和自动化特征提取能力,正在重塑多个行业。本文将深入探讨深度学习的基本概念、主要特点、应用场景、面临的挑战及解决方案,并展望其未来发展趋势,为企业IT决策者提供实用指导。

一、深度学习的基本概念

深度学习是机器学习的一个子领域,其核心思想是通过多层神经网络模拟人脑的学习过程。与传统的机器学习方法相比,深度学习能够自动从数据中提取特征,而无需人工设计特征。这种能力使其在处理复杂数据(如图像、语音和文本)时表现出色。

二、深度学习的主要特点

  1. 自动化特征提取
    深度学习通过多层神经网络自动学习数据中的特征,减少了人工干预,提高了模型的泛化能力。

  2. 强大的数据处理能力
    深度学习能够处理海量数据,尤其是在图像识别、自然语言处理等领域,其性能远超传统方法。

  3. 端到端学习
    深度学习模型可以从原始数据直接输出最终结果,简化了传统机器学习中的多步骤流程。

  4. 非线性建模能力
    深度学习通过多层非线性变换,能够捕捉数据中的复杂关系,适用于高维数据的建模。

三、深度学习的应用场景

  1. 计算机视觉
    深度学习在图像分类、目标检测、人脸识别等领域取得了显著成果。例如,自动驾驶汽车通过深度学习技术识别道路上的行人和车辆。

  2. 自然语言处理
    深度学习在机器翻译、情感分析、语音识别等任务中表现出色。例如,智能语音助手(如Siri、Alexa)依赖于深度学习技术理解用户指令。

  3. 医疗诊断
    深度学习在医学影像分析、疾病预测等方面展现出巨大潜力。例如,通过深度学习分析CT影像,可以辅助医生早期发现癌症。

  4. 金融风控
    深度学习在欺诈检测、信用评分等金融领域得到广泛应用。例如,银行利用深度学习模型实时监测异常交易行为。

四、深度学习在不同场景下的挑战

  1. 数据需求量大
    深度学习模型通常需要大量标注数据,但在某些领域(如医疗),获取高质量数据较为困难。

  2. 计算资源消耗高
    训练深度学习模型需要强大的计算资源,尤其是GPU或TPU,这对中小企业来说可能是一笔不小的开支。

  3. 模型可解释性差
    深度学习模型通常被视为“黑箱”,其决策过程难以解释,这在某些高风险的领域(如医疗、金融)可能引发信任问题。

  4. 过拟合风险
    深度学习模型容易在训练数据上表现良好,但在新数据上表现不佳,即过拟合问题。

五、解决深度学习挑战的方法

  1. 数据增强与迁移学习
    通过数据增强技术(如旋转、裁剪图像)增加训练数据的多样性,或利用迁移学习在预训练模型的基础上进行微调,减少对大量标注数据的依赖。

  2. 分布式计算与模型压缩
    采用分布式计算框架(如TensorFlow、PyTorch)加速模型训练,或通过模型压缩技术(如剪枝、量化)降低计算资源需求。

  3. 可解释性研究
    开发可解释性工具(如LIME、SHAP)帮助理解模型的决策过程,或采用注意力机制等透明性更高的模型结构。

  4. 正则化与早停法
    通过正则化技术(如L2正则化、Dropout)防止模型过拟合,或使用早停法在验证集性能下降时停止训练。

六、未来发展趋势

  1. 自监督学习
    自监督学习通过利用未标注数据预训练模型,减少对标注数据的依赖,是未来深度学习的重要方向。

  2. 边缘计算与联邦学习
    随着物联网设备的普及,深度学习将向边缘计算发展,同时联邦学习技术可以在保护数据隐私的前提下实现模型训练。

  3. 多模态学习
    多模态学习通过整合多种数据源(如图像、文本、语音)提升模型性能,将在智能交互、虚拟现实等领域发挥重要作用。

  4. 伦理与法规
    随着深度学习的广泛应用,其伦理和法规问题将受到更多关注,如数据隐私、算法公平性等。

深度学习以其强大的数据处理能力和自动化特征提取能力,正在推动人工智能技术的快速发展。尽管面临数据需求量大、计算资源消耗高、模型可解释性差等挑战,但通过数据增强、迁移学习、分布式计算等解决方案,这些问题正在逐步得到缓解。未来,随着自监督学习、边缘计算、多模态学习等技术的发展,深度学习将在更多领域展现其巨大潜力。企业IT决策者应密切关注这些趋势,结合自身业务需求,制定合理的深度学习应用策略,以在数字化转型中占据先机。

原创文章,作者:IT_learner,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/61875

(0)